Suspicious person call results in arrest of sex offender out of compliance early Wednesday morning

On Wednesday, July 6th, 2022, at 2:30 am, the Turlock Police Department was dispatched to a reported suspicious person in the 2600 block of Porsche Strasse, after a resident in the area spotted a man he did not recognize walking around and getting into a vehicle that did not belong to him.

When officers arrived in the area, they made contact with Guillermo Hernandez, 31, of Turlock, and discovered that he was a sex offender who was not in compliance. He was also on post release community supervision for burglary and an arson registrant.

Officers made contact with the owner of the vehicle that Hernandez was seen getting into and determined that no crime had been committed.

Hernandez was arrested and booked into the Stanislaus County Public Safety Center on charges of being a sex offender based on a felony conviction or juvenile adjudication out of compliance.
